你查询的IP:[202.96.173.185]  地理位置:中国–广东–东莞

最新查询117.128.178.57 119.232.46.221 202.192.95.118 221.199.224.133 116.242.81.195 123.64.228.164 122.48.141.210 120.192.162.61 202.90.233.35 202.96.173.185 61.128.225.107 61.4.80.59 203.86.108.224 203.128.32.118 210.78.255.0 202.125.176.110 124.240.128.232 218.139.235.160 202.189.80.108 203.100.80.103 219.242.174.146 203.212.80.186 116.60.189.236 121.52.224.142 210.2.14.17 119.16.64.159 124.112.100.124 203.100.32.81 122.112.151.195 124.31.135.24 59.191.240.197